I was looking at the Canes' new marketing plan http://www.carolinahurricanes.com/images/relaunch.pdf, and the offer for group tickets on opening night is too good to pass up (especially since that game is highly unlikely to be in a 10-game pack).

Basically, if you buy 20 or more tickets to Opening Night, you get an allotment for the same number of tickets that can be used for a group of club-selected games. No word on which games, how many there will be to choose from, if the free tickets will be in the same price area as the ones purchased, or if you have to use all of the free tickets together (I'd guess yes to the third and no to the last).

The free tickets have to be used together - it's like a repeat of whatever we get for Opening Night. He said they don't have the schedule, but that aside from a few blacked-out games, just about any game is good for the free tickets.

I don't know where everyone wants to sit, but here are the prices for a group of 21-49 and 50-149.

Upper Corners $19, $17
Balcony Premier $26, $24
Club Level $60, $55
Center Ice Club $85, $75
LL North $47, $42
LL South $52, $47
Sideline Premier $75, $60
Center Ice Premier $80, $70
